No. 4: Hill Top Tavern
Location: 4907 Lowell Blvd.
Diner? Drive-In? Or Dive? Dive dudes. Right in the working-class part of town sits this working-man’s tavern. No frills here, and it’s good that way. The only food is microwaved frozen pizzas and pitchers of beer run for $7. If that's not enough of a dive definition for ya…the pool tables will sometimes have all the balls for players and the ceiling has hundreds of pool stick holes punctured all over it. It's how regulars and newcomers alike make their mark. The joint won't run a tab, either. There's a flimsy cardboard sign that reads "we do not accept credit cards" written in Sharpie marker. The old fashioned jukebox features old '80s and '90s hits from Lynyrd Skynyrd to Santana and still gets the bar crowd singing along early and often. You can smoke to your heart’s content on the large outdoor patio and you'll always leave with a few more friends than you came in with.
What it's known for: Regulars boast about the place when Regis University alum Bill Murray (the star from 'Ground Hog's Day') stops in when he's in town. But in reality, the college and blue-collar crowd make this bar a true ol' dive. Sip a few pints of beer...they have a vast selection of tap brews (PBR, Bud Light and Busch…yep a whopping three) and snap a few cheesy yo' mama jokes with the regulars. Play a round of pool, make your mark in the ceiling and listen to a few oldies songs on the juke. Now, you're officially a Hill Topper for life. Welcome!
